Ontario Native Plants is a growing online nursery dedicated to cultivating and distributing native plants sourced from Ontario seed. Our commitment to quality, sustainability, and exceptional customer service has made us a trusted provider across the province. As we expand, we are seeking an Assistant Manager to help drive operational excellence and support our team throughout the busy growing and shipping seasons.

In this role, you will work closely with the Manager to oversee daily operations, lead supervisors and seasonal staff, and ensure smooth fulfillment and customer satisfaction. Your contributions will be vital to maintaining our high standards and supporting our mission of sustainable horticulture.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Supporting day-to-day operations alongside the Manager
  • Helping lead supervisors and seasonal staff, including hiring, onboarding, and training
  • Managing customer emails and resolving shipping issues
  • Coordinating shipping schedules and capacity
  • Maintaining online inventory and plant listings
  • Assisting with ordering, reporting, and administrative tasks
  • Supporting packing, pickups, and workflow during busy periods
  • Stepping in to manage operations when the Manager is away

Hours

This role follows the seasons and hours fluctuate based on demand.

·         May to June (peak season) about 50 to 55 hours per week, including some Saturdays

·         March, April, July, August about 40 to 45 hours per week

·         September to November about 30 to 40 hours per week

·         December to February about 30 hours per week, mostly computer and planning work

Flexibility during the busy season is important.
